Can You Get a Personal Loan for Dental Work?
One question that many patients have is whether it is possible to get a medical loan for dental work. A personal loan is a type of loan that individuals can use for just about anything. Due to the inherent flexibility of a personal loan, many individuals apply for personal loans to pay for out-of-pocket dental expenses.
In general, a medical loan for dental work has a lower interest rate than a credit card. The average interest rate for a credit card hovers around 16 percent. On the other hand, personal loans can have interest rates as low as five percent. Accordingly, most people find it more advantageous to use a medical loan for dental work to cover the costs than to use a credit card for medical expenses.
After all, a lower interest rate translates to a lower monthly payment. Many people also find that the terms associated with a personal loan are more favorable than the terms associated with their dentist’s payment plan.
Not only are personal loans versatile in terms of what you can use them for, but they are also flexible when it comes to how much you can borrow. A personal loan for medical bills can amount to as little as $500 to as much as $100,000. However, depending on the state in which you reside, you may face some restrictions in terms of how much you can loan. Can I Get a Medical Loan for Dental Implants?
A dental implant refers to a surgical component that interacts with the bone of the skull or jaw to support a crown, denture, bridge, facial prosthesis, or another type of dental prosthesis. Dental implants can also function as an orthodontic anchor. In general, patients get dental implants after losing a tooth due to injury or periodontal disease.
Unfortunately, many patients struggle to afford dental implants. The average dental implant procedure costs $3,000 to $10,000. A dental implant can cost even more if additional procedures are needed. Some examples of procedures that may be performed in addition to a dental implant include bone grafts, sinus lifts, extractions, and tissue grafts.
Dental coverage may limit or exclude benefits for dental implants. Of course, some patients don’t have dental coverage at all.
